      ​@@jillpemberton1434 Yes, the sea between Sabah and Philippines isn't quite safe, typical tourists don't travel by ferry across that area. Usually only locals (fishermen etc.) travel across that route by boat.
      In the 2000s and 2010s there were some high profile kidnapping cases by pirates and/or terrorists from the Philippines. There was even an armed incursion on Malaysian soil by Sulu militia in 2013 that tried to "claim back their homeland" (this kind of attack has never happened before), fortunately it was quickly put down by the Malaysian military.
      That event has since then knocked some sense into Malaysia's federal government & the general public of Malaysia, and the navy and marine police have since then carried out constant patrol on the surrounding waters and tourism islands.

    Malaysia is a great country to visit for a few months but current MM2H visa requirements make it hard for the average person to qualify. All 3 programs (Peninsular, Sarawak, Sabah) require a large fixed deposit and high monthly income. Program administration has been bounced between immigration and tourism departments, delaying processing times. Many applicants wait months only to find out their application is denied or they receive numerous requests for more documents. Hope they can fix this someday!

      @@jillpemberton1434 The Malaysian government site is outdated. Talk to a registered agent for updated details. The government changed the program several times over the last few years to "attract a higher caliber" of applicants. There are several versions/levels of the MM2H program based on geography, plus a premium high net worth program and digital nomad visa program. And I think the Labuan business investment program is still available.

    Did you mention the US$1 million government deposit and proof of US$9k per month guaranteed external income you need to qualify for a visa that's only valid for a limited period? Few people qualify for that and certainly none struggling financially and using food banks in their own country.
    Always sunny and hot? That may have been your experience on your holiday but weeks can go by with just grey skies. In El Niño years, that can extend to months. Healthcare is pretty good, that is unless you need trauma car in which case you're in the third world where no healthcare insurance will make a difference. That's worth bearing in mind when you consider Malaysia has one of the highest road casualty rates in the world. Yes you can supposedly drink the water but locals don't which tells you all you need to know.
    Malaysians are totally irresponsible in terms of dealing with rubbish. If it's in their hands, it's their problem. If they drop it, it becomes someone else's problem and this applies to everything from litter to toxic industrial waste. The pollution in KL and the wider Klang valley is ever present due to the amount of industry, older polluting vehicles exacerbated by geographical and climatic conditions that trap the pollution. California is similar in that respect and was the birthplace of most emission legislation. Pollution alone is reason not to stay too long anywhere in the Klang valley.
    Alcohol used to be cheap but successive racist governments have raised taxes, mainly to keep it out of the hands of Malays who despite religious restrictions, love it. The slow decline into the deep, dark abyss of conservative Islam has been mirrored by removing people's ability to enjoy themselves. It used to be so much better here.
